Transaction 74e74bef2f522d5b210d5d4cb5d6b350fb5d1a109fb0b60cddf1e3c5e0bf032a

2 Input
1 Outputs
  • 74e74bef2f522d5b210d5d4cb5d6b350fb5d1a109fb0b60cddf1e3c5e0bf032a:0
  • value  3838733
    address  12pMFYbrPufnV6TmmU3L2FG5o6zUVwKuZR